What is PYTH coin
PYTH Network is a decentralized oracle system on the Solana blockchain, providing accurate and timely real-time data for smart contracts through a network of verifying nodes.

The PYTH Network is a decentralized oracle network that provides real-time data to smart contracts on the Solana blockchain. PYTH is the native token of the PYTH Network and is used to incentivize nodes to provide accurate and timely data.
How does PYTH work?The PYTH Network is composed of a group of nodes that are responsible for collecting and verifying data from a variety of sources. These sources include exchanges, market makers, and other data providers. Once the data has been collected, it is aggregated and published to the Solana blockchain.
Smart contracts can then access the data from the PYTH Network to execute complex operations. For example, a smart contract could use PYTH data to determine the price of an asset or to calculate the value of a financial instrument.
Benefits of using PYTHThere are a number of benefits to using PYTH, including:
- Accuracy: PYTH data is highly accurate because it is aggregated from a variety of sources.
- Timeliness: PYTH data is published in real-time, so smart contracts can always access the most up-to-date information.
- Transparency: The PYTH Network is open and transparent, so anyone can verify the accuracy of the data.
- Security: The PYTH Network is secured by the Solana blockchain, which is one of the most secure blockchains in the world.
PYTH can be used in a variety of applications, including:
- Decentralized finance (DeFi): PYTH data can be used to create DeFi applications that are more accurate and efficient.
- Prediction markets: PYTH data can be used to create prediction markets that are more accurate and reliable.
- Gaming: PYTH data can be used to create games that are more realistic and engaging.
- Supply chain management: PYTH data can be used to optimize supply chains and improve efficiency.
The PYTH team is composed of a group of experienced professionals with backgrounds in finance, technology, and blockchain. The team is led by Duncan Forster, who is the former CEO of HC Technologies.
The PYTH roadmapThe PYTH team is working on a number of initiatives to improve the network, including:
- Expanding the number of data sources: The team is working to add more data sources to the network, which will improve the accuracy and reliability of the data.
- Developing new features: The team is working on developing new features for the network, such as the ability to create custom data feeds.
- Growing the community: The team is working to grow the PYTH community by educating developers and users about the benefits of the network.
The PYTH Network is a powerful tool that can be used to build a variety of blockchain applications. The network is accurate, timely, transparent, and secure. The team is working on a number of initiatives to improve the network, and the future of PYTH is bright.
